Colchicine combination therapy increases treatment tolerance in patients with arthritis: A systematic review and meta-analysis.
<h4>Background</h4>Arthritis seriously affects people's quality of life, and there is an urgent clinical need to improve the efficacy of medications as well as to reduce the adverse effects induced by treatment. Combined colchicine therapy is gradually being embraced in clinical car...
